I’ve enough practice with the G-Man to pick it back up quick. The weight maps are no hassle just a little time consuming setting them up. Basically, as we are looking at a ‘hard-body’ each piece has it’s own weightmap which is tied to the bone driving it. The bone has to have it’s pivot at the hinge for that item. I tend to group parts that won’t interfere, so all ‘forearms’ use the same weight map as the left & right forearms won’t cross-influence, neither will the inner and outer. :slight_smile:
